New Haven Seo Services | Plano Texas Logo Design | Rochester Seo Company | Dayton Search Engine Optimization Consulting | Ontario Search Engine Optimization Firm | Arlington Search Engine Optimization Expert | Elk Grove Search Engine Optimization Firm